Job Description:
We need a passionate and experienced mental health nurse to work in a well-established team at an acute hospital in South West England, assisting and supporting general hospital colleagues in making decisions about treatment and care in complex situations.
Description:
The priority for the post holder will be to provide:
* High level of nursing and observation
* Delivering a range of nursing and psychosocial interventions to help reduce patients’ distress
* Assist and support general hospital colleagues in making decisions about treatment and care in complex situations
* Provide one-to-one nursing for behaviorally disturbed, distressed, or confused patients
* Offer support and advice to patients presenting with a range of undifferentiated mental health, psychological problems, and psychiatric illnesses
* Deliver a range of nursing and psychosocial interventions to individual patients and their families, as appropriate
* Represent mental health services within the general hospital
Skills:
* Demonstrable experience of working in a mental health setting
* Knowledge and experience of adult safeguarding procedures
* Ability to restrain patients using approved techniques
* Handling and appropriately storing patient valuables
* Ability to deal with emotional and distressing situations
* Excellent interpersonal skills
* Respect for the privacy and dignity of individuals
* Ability to manage demanding situations
* Ability to cope with exposure to aggressive behavior
* Ability to plan own workload
* Knowledge of Mental Health presentations and appropriate interventions
* Understanding of the NMC Code of Conduct
* Knowledge of risk management and how to plan care to account for risk
